Understanding Passive House Principles

The Passive House standard is a rigorous, voluntary standard for energy efficiency in a building, reducing its ecological footprint. It results in ultra-low energy buildings that require little energy for space heating or cooling. Core principles include:

  • Thermal Insulation: High levels of insulation minimize heat loss, maintaining a consistent indoor temperature.
  • Airtightness: Buildings are sealed to prevent any air leakage, which contributes significantly to energy savings.
  • High-Performance Windows: Triple-glazed windows with insulated frames reduce heat loss and maximize solar gain.
  • Mechanical Ventilation with Heat Recovery: This system ensures fresh air supply while retaining heat from exhaust air.
  • Thermal Bridge-Free Construction: Design and construction techniques eliminate thermal bridges, reducing energy loss.

Benefits of Passive House Design

Opting for Passive House design offers numerous benefits for both the environment and homeowners. These include:

  • Reduced Energy Costs: Significant savings on heating and cooling bills due to minimal energy requirements.
  • Increased Comfort: Consistent indoor temperatures and high air quality contribute to a comfortable living environment.
  • Environmental Impact: Reduced carbon emissions contribute to environmental conservation efforts.
  • Durability and Low Maintenance: High-quality materials and construction techniques ensure longevity and minimal upkeep.

Challenges in Implementing Passive House Standards

While the benefits of Passive House standards are substantial, there are challenges involved in their implementation:

  • Initial Costs: High upfront investment may be a deterrent for some homeowners.
  • Complexity of Design: Requires precise planning and specialized knowledge to ensure standards are met.
  • Limited Availability of Materials: High-performance materials may not be readily available in all regions.
  • Regulatory Hurdles: Navigating building codes and regulations can be complex.
